plugins:showblogs

差分

この文書の現在のバージョンと選択したバージョンの差分を表示します。

この比較画面にリンクする

plugins:showblogs [2011/03/23 21:28] (現在)
ライン 1: ライン 1:
 +====== NP_ShowBlogs ======
 +**標準のスキン変数<​%blog%>​との互換性を持つ、多機能なアイテム一覧プラグイン。数あるNucleusプラグインの中でも、特に愛用者が多いプラグインです。**
  
 +^General Plugin info ^^
 +^作者: | [[plugins:​authors:​nakahara21|nakahara21]] , [[plugins:​authors:​Taka|Taka]] , [[plugins:​authors:​kimitake|kimitake]] , [[plugins:​authors:​shizuki|shizuki]] |
 +^Version: | Ver2.7(2007/​05/​08) |
 +^Download: | [[http://​japan.nucleuscms.org/​bb/​download/​file.php?​id=976|NP_ShowBlogs-2.7.zip]] (10.76kb) |  ​
 +^ソース: |  |
 +^フォーラム参照先:​ |http://​japan.nucleuscms.org/​bb/​viewtopic.php?​t=355|
 +
 +
 +=====インストール方法=====
 +
 +
 +
 +
 +=====このプラグインの使い方=====
 +
 +基本的には、<​%blog(template)%>​と書く代わりに<​%ShowBlogs(template)%>​と記述するだけです。これによりデフォルトでページスイッチが表示され、過去のアイテムへのアクセスがしやすくなります。
 +
 +
 +=====スキン/​テンプレートへの記述=====
 +
 +<​%ShowBlogs([テンプレート],​ [アイテム数],​ [ブログ],​ [ページスイッチ],​ [ソート],​ [固定表示ID],​ [固定表示テンプレート],​ [カテゴリーモード],​ [広告コード表示モード],​ [カテゴリ選択時の固定記事の表示方法])%>​
 +
 +
 +  * テンプレート
 +     テンプレート名(例:default/​index)
 +  * アイテム数
 +     1ページ中に表示するアイテムの数
 +  * ブログ
 +     * 空白 -> カレントのブログ
 +     * 1/2/5 -> ID1・2・5のブログ
 +     * <>3/6 -> ID3・6以外のブログ(先頭に<>​を付ける)
 +     * all -> 全てのブログ
 +  * ページスイッチ 通常はページの上下に表示。小数点以下を 1 にすると上だけ 9 にすると下だけ表示
 +     * 0:ページスイッチ非表示。
 +     * 1または1.1・1.9:<<​Prev||Next>>​ (デフォルト値)
 +     * 2または2.1・2.9:<<​Prev|| 1 . 2 . 3 . . . 18 . 19 . 20||Next>>​
 +     * 3または3.1・3.9:<<​Prev|| . . . . 3 . 4 . 5 . 6 .7 . . . . ||Next>>​
 +  * ソート
 +     * DESC アイテム日付降順
 +     * ASC  アイテム日付昇順
 +  * 固定表示ID
 +     * 固定表示させるアイテムIDを記入("/"​で区切って複数指定可)
 +  * 固定表示テンプレート
 +     * 固定表示アイテムに使うテンプレート
 +     * 無記入なら通常記事表示と同じテンプレートを使用
 +  * カテゴリーモード
 +     * 1/2/5 の様に、表示したいカテゴリーを '/'​ で区切って記述する事で、指定したカテゴリーのアイテムのみ表示
 +     * <>3/6 のように、先頭に '<>'​ をつけるとその ID のカテゴリーは表示されません
 +  * 広告コード表示モード
 +     * 0 : 広告コードを表示しません ​
 +     * 1以上 : 広告コードを表示します
 +  * カテゴリ選択時の固定記事の表示方法
 +     * 0 : カテゴリ選択時は固定アイテムの表示を解除
 +     * 1以上 : 選択しているカテゴリに所属する固定アイテムのみ表示
 +
 +
 +このドキュメントを書くに辺り[[http://​go.gogo.tc/?​itemid=835|生獣 - 観察記録 [NP_ShowBlogsの使い方。]]]を参考にさせていただきました
 +
 +
 +=====オプション=====
 +{{ :​plugins:​showblogs_option.gif ​ |NP_ShowBlogsのオプション画面}}
 +  * 1番目\\ テンプレートに、各記事が属するカテゴリ名表示用変数[[skins:​vars:​category|<​%category%>​]]を書いた箇所に表示するフォーマット。\\ allブログモード時のみ有効。
 +    * 0:​『カテゴリ名 on ブログ名』
 +    * 1:​カテゴリ名のみ
 +    * 2:​ブログ名のみ
 +  * 2番目\\ 固定表示記事の指定リストを表示中のブログに属する記事だけに絞り込んで表示する可動化の指定。\\ allブログモード時では無効。
 +    * 0:​フィルタリングせず、パラメータ指定の記事すべてを固定表示。
 +    * 1:​表示中のブログに属する記事だけを固定表示。
 +  * 3番目\\ 1つ目の記事と2つ目の記事の間に挿入するコード。主に広告挿入で使用する。\\ 入力されたテキストがそのまま埋め込まれます。Nucleus変数は使えません。
 +
 +=====Tipsと裏技=====
 +[[http://​mahal.jpn.ph/​item/​161|ページスイッチリンクをFancyURL化]]
 +
 +===== 既知の問題点 =====
 +  * オプションで間に挿入するコードを指定している場合はRSS出力用に使用できない。
 +  * 特定ブログ(カテゴリ)の指定(除外)をパラメータで指定できない。
 +
 +
 +
 +=====開発履歴=====
 +  * version 2.7 [2007-05-07]
 +    * doIf対応バージョン。ページスイッチ表示変更機能搭載。
 +  * version 2.66.2 [2006-11-30]
 +    * 不具合修正
 +  * version 2.66 [2006-11-27]
 +    * 機能アップ諸々
 +  * version 2.61 [2006-09-20]
 +    * security fix by kimitake
 +  * version 2.5 [2006-05-11]
 +    * 日付ヘッダのバグ修正。
 +    * (NP_TagEXの)あるタグが指定された記事を複数のblog間から抽出して一括表示できるように。
 +    * $_SERVER['​REQUEST_URI'​]を返さない環境に対応。
 +    * ページスイッチの追加と改良。
 +  * version 2.04 [2005-11-01]
 +    * NP_TagEX対応。 ​
 +  * version 2.01 [2005-07-07]
 +    * 1番目の記事の後に広告等を挿入する機能を付加。
 +    * 無限階層のサブカテゴリ対応。 ​
 +  * version 2.00 [2004-06-22]
 +    * php4.0.6でもページ切替えできるように。 ​
 +    * 固定表示アイテムの表示に使うテンプレートをパラメータで指定できるように(指定しない場合は通常記事表示と同じテンプレートを使います)。 ​
 +    * 複数stickyID指定の際は、表示blogに属する物だけを抽出して固定表示できるように(抽出しないで全部表示も可能)。 ​
 +    * allモードの時は、カテゴリ名の表示形式を選択できるように。 ​
 +    * マルチカテゴリ対応(マルチ使っていなくてももちろん大丈夫)。
 +  * version 1.03 [2004-04-09]
 +  * version 0.3s [2004-01-06]
 +  * version 0.3 [2003-12-09]
 +  * version 0.24 [2003-11-13]
 +  * version 0.22 [2003-11-13]
 +  * version 0.12 [2003-11-12]
 
plugins/showblogs.txt · 最終更新: 2011/03/23 21:28 (外部編集)